Pastoral Care
Our community seeks to show the compassionate presence of Jesus Christ, by providing spiritual care and support to those who are ill, hurting, or in need. The Pastoral Care Team is an expression of this care of the community through reaching out to those who are in special need for spiritual care. In serving others we are serving Christ; Jesus cared for all people and he commanded us to love one another: "As I have loved you, so you must love one another so all men will know that you are my disciples, if you love one another." (John 13:34.35) It is important to continue fellowship with parishioners who are unable to worship with us for whatever reason. They are part of God's Family, our family; and as such our love for one another is the fruit of our relationship to God.
